Pre-printing Preparation

Dry Out Before UseRecommended
Drying Condition70-80°C, (8-12h)
ACE Pro CompatibilityCompatible

Recommended Settings

Printing Temperature240-280℃
Heated Bed Temperature80-100℃
Printing Speed50-150mm/s
Cooling Time6s
Maximum Volume Speed(Flow Rate)15mm³/s

Material Performance - Physical Properties

Density1.05 g/m³
Melt Flow Index g/10min30-35 g/10 min (210℃/2.16 kg)
Melting Point Temperature180℃
Vicat Softening Temperature95℃
Heat Deflection Temperature85℃
Saturated Water Absorption Rate0.65%

Material Performance - Mechanical Properties

Tensile Modulus2200Mpa
Tensile Strength34MPa
Tensile Strength (Z)22MPa
Elongation at Break11%
Bending Modulus2200MPa
Bending Strength63MPa
Izod Impact Strength (X-Y)40KJ/m²

How does Anycubic ABS filament minimize warping during full-bed printing?

The filament is engineered with optimized anti-warping properties. It supports a 220mm×220mm anti-warping print area with a heated bed maintained at 100℃, significantly reducing thermal stress during printing. This design helps ensure stable prints, even when using larger build volumes compared to other materials that are more prone to warping.

What are the recommended printing settings for using Anycubic ABS filament?

For optimal results, it’s recommended to pre-dry the filament at 70℃–80℃ for 8–12 hours. During printing, use a temperature range of 240℃–280℃ with a heated bed set between 80℃–100℃. A printing speed of 50–150 mm/s, a cooling time of about 6 seconds, and a maximum volumetric flow rate of 15 mm³/s are advised to achieve high-quality prints while maintaining material integrity.
